The image displays the grand western facade of the Strasbourg Cathedral, located in Strasbourg, France, viewed from a pedestrian perspective in a public square. The Gothic cathedral is constructed from reddish-brown sandstone, featuring a single, towering spire on the left, an intricately detailed facade with a large circular rose window, and multiple deeply sculpted portals at its base. Above, the sky is clear and blue. Flanking the cathedral are multi-story buildings. On the left, a traditional Alsatian half-timbered building with dark wooden beams and white infill sections features numerous windows with closed shutters. A sign for "AUX DOUZE APOTRES" (To the Twelve Apostles) is visible at the ground level of this building. On the right, a building with a light beige or pinkish stucco facade rises, also featuring multiple windows with closed white shutters and arched ground-floor sections. The foreground consists of a paved square or street, where approximately fifteen to twenty individuals are present. Most are observed walking or standing, dressed in varied casual modern clothing. Two individuals are partially visible in the extreme foreground, out of focus. Direct sunlight illuminates the scene, casting pronounced shadows across the right side of the cathedral's facade and the paved ground.
